Stanley bits? 575?
For info - solved by the guys on uk.d-i-y....
It is a depth stop. Once I had the thing in place I was amazed at how simple it was to adjust and how well it worked. Just slacken off the wingnuts and screw the guide up or down as necessary. http://www.oofus.com/pix/RBPics/Odds/GuideOnBit-1.jpg http://www.oofus.com/pix/RBPics/Odds/GuideOnBit-2.jpg http://www.toolsrules.com/ST49BG.JPG Roy |
